Safety Day for kids held at Tofield Arena

On July 18th, the Town of Tofield’s 40 registered children in the Summer Program were in for a treat at the Tofield Arena where they got to learn all about safety.

The children got to go on a school bus while driver Sheryl Laarhuis explained what they were to do to be safe while on a bus ride, as well as how their parents were supposed to drive their vehicles when a bus stops to let children off.

During their safety day excursion, they met EMTs Ryan Meagher and Phillip Waters, who let the children sit on the stretcher in the back of the EMS bus. Here the children learned how everything worked in the EMS vehicle, along with how the EMT remain safe while helping their patient.
